There’s been a lot of talk about generational divides over the past few years.

But while boomers, Gen X, millennials, and Gen Z tend to be the subjects of those conversations, you don’t hear a lot about the Silent Generation.

For those who aren’t familiar with this generation, it includes those born roughly between the years 1928 and 1945 — just before the boomers.

So, why are they called the Silent Generation? According to a TIME article from 1951: “Youth today is waiting for the hand of fate to fall on its shoulders, meanwhile working fairly hard and saying almost nothing. The most startling fact about the younger generation is its silence. With some rare exceptions, youth is nowhere near the rostrum. By comparison with the Flaming Youth of their fathers & mothers, today’s younger generation is a still, small flame. It does not issue manifestoes, make speeches, or carry posters.”
